They are a sight to gladden the heart of even the weariest commuter and harassed passer-by. Spilling from red phone boxes, tumbling out of a dustbin, and garlanding the famed statue of Eros in Piccadilly Circus, this verdant series of floral displays sprang up overnight on Sunday in the heart of central London. Part floral arrangement, part street art, the stunning displays are known as ‘flower flashes’ and are the brainchild of Lewis Miller, a 47-year-old florist dubbed ‘Botanical Banksy’ in his native New York.
